M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


3 participantes

    Tabelas relacionadas em combo box

    avatar
    sergio-pereira
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 27
    Registrado : 13/02/2011

    Tabelas relacionadas em combo box Empty Tabelas relacionadas em combo box

    Mensagem  sergio-pereira 30/5/2013, 13:06

    Bom dia, estou com uma dificuldade que embora me pareça simples não consigo ultrapassar, falta de prática, peço a ajuda do forum.
    O problema é o seguinte, tenho 3 tabelas designadas por "01 Distrito", "02 Concelho" e "03 Clientes".

    A tabela "01 Distrito" é composta pelos seguintes campos:
    DD (Código do distrito) - Chave
    DESIG (Designação do distrito)

    A tabela "02 Concelho" é composta pelos seguintes campos:
    DD (Código do distrito) - Chave
    CC (Código do concelho) - Chave
    DESIG (Designação do concelho)

    Criei na base de dados os relacionamentos entre estas duas tabelas sendo que a cada distrito correspondem os respectivos concelhos. Até aqui penso não existirem problemas. E tudo funciona bem.

    A tabela "03 Clientes" onde entre outros campos relativamente à morada tem os campos "Distrito" e "Concelho" do tipo Caixa de combinação com origem da linha na tabela "01 Distrito" e "02 Concelho" respectivamente.

    Pretendia que após seleccionado o "Distrito" o campo "Concelho" me de-se a hipótese de apenas seleccionar os concelhos correspondentes àquele distrito. Já consegui faze-lo num formulário mas apenas o consigo fazer no primeiro registo depois dá sempre a listagem dos concelhos do distrito do primeiro registo.

    Peço por favor que me informem qual a melhor maneira de resolver este problema, se é possível tal nas tabelas, se apenas nos formulários e qual a melhor solução.

    Muito obrigado

    Sérgio

    Prototipo abaixo


    Última edição por sergio-pereira em 30/5/2013, 16:19, editado 1 vez(es)
    Finformática
    Finformática
    VIP
    V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1098
    Registrado : 23/03/2010

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  Finformática 30/5/2013, 13:29

    Caro Sérgio,
    Veja se este exemplo lhe ajuda. Tente adaptar para suas tabelas e seus campos. Pelo que entendi acho que é esse seu problema.
    Este primeiro select é referente a primeira caixa de combinação: Combinação18
    SELECT TbMala.Colaborador, TbMala.NomeSolicitante, TbMala.Homônimo FROM TbMala;

    Este é o segundo select onde deve colocar o WHERE referente à combinação anterior para filtrar. O segredo é esse.
    SELECT TbMala.NomeSolicitante, TbMala.Colaborador, TbMala.Homônimo FROM TbMala WHERE (((TbMala.Colaborador)=Forms![JU - Cadastra Processos]!Combinação18));

    Tente aí e mande respostas

    Boa sorte, abraços
    avatar
    sergio-pereira
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 27
    Registrado : 13/02/2011

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  sergio-pereira 30/5/2013, 14:00

    Percebo muito pouco de vba, este código é para inscrever no formulário? Será que existe uma maneira mais fácil de explicar o processo, peço deculpa!
    Fernando Bueno
    Fernando Bueno
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2115
    Registrado : 13/04/2012

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  Fernando Bueno 30/5/2013, 14:12

    Bom dia colegas.

    Isso lhe ajudara a entender melhor o que nosso amigo lhe ensinou veja:

    http://maximoaccess.forumeiros.com/t50-filtragem-em-cascata?highlight=Filtragem+em+cascata


    .................................................................................
    Um abraço
    Fernando Bueno


    O aumento do conhecimento é como uma esfera dilatando-se no espaço
    quanto maior a nossa compreensão,
    maior o nosso contacto com o desconhecido
    Tabelas relacionadas em combo box 16rzeq
    avatar
    sergio-pereira
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 27
    Registrado : 13/02/2011

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  sergio-pereira 30/5/2013, 14:46

    Peço desculpa mas a situação em referência não me parece idêntica essa parece-me bem fácil uma vez que as combo vão buscar os dados a uma mesma tabela, vou postar um exemplo para ver se fica mais fácil explicar o que pretendo.
    Finformática
    Finformática
    VIP
    VIP


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1098
    Registrado : 23/03/2010

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  Finformática 30/5/2013, 15:18

    Caro Sérgio,

    No seu formulário você tem dois botões de combinação. É isto?
    Não necessita você escrever a linha. Ambos você pode criar via ASSISTENTE. No segundo você acrescenta o WHERE com o filtro acima citado.
    Fui mais claro?

    Abraços
    avatar
    sergio-pereira
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 27
    Registrado : 13/02/2011

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  sergio-pereira 30/5/2013, 15:29

    Aqui vai um prototipo, obrigado pela atenção realmente qualquer problema trazido a este forum tem uma atenção imediata, sou um amador em access pelo que peço desculpa se não entendo certas questões
    Anexos
    Tabelas relacionadas em combo box Attachmentcp.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(32 Kb) Baixado 14 vez(es)
    avatar
    sergio-pereira
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 27
    Registrado : 13/02/2011

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  sergio-pereira 30/5/2013, 15:40

    Shocked
    avatar
    Convidado
    Convidado


    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  Convidado 30/5/2013, 16:51

    Bom dia Sergio,

    Da uma olhada e vê se é isso que precisa.


    Nivaldo.
    avatar
    sergio-pereira
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 27
    Registrado : 13/02/2011

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  sergio-pereira 30/5/2013, 16:58

    Obrigado pela ajuda Divaldo, o exemplo que trabalhou ficou com erros, se reparar, agora realmente dá para seleccionar mas ao mudar de registo assume o mesmo para todos e além disso não os inscreve na tabela.

    Aff isto até me parecia facil mas afinal nem será, pelos vistos


    Shocked

    Mesmo que não resolva a questão nem sei como vos agradecer pela vossa disponibilidade e simpatia
    avatar
    Convidado
    Convidado


    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  Convidado 30/5/2013, 17:21

    Olá Sergio,

    Acrescentei alguns registros e ficaram todos gravados na tabela.
    No formulário FormClientes tem dois campos (Distrito e Concelho) que deixei com a propriedade visível com Não. Mude para ficarem visíveis e verá que as informações mudam conforme a navegação dos registros.

    As combos, nesse caso, irão servir só para você filtrar os Concelhos pelo Distrito selecionado.

    Persistindo a dúvida, é só gritar.


    Nivaldo.
    avatar
    sergio-pereira
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 27
    Registrado : 13/02/2011

    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  sergio-pereira 31/5/2013, 19:00

    Obrigado a todos, já entendi, apliquei e resultou, são fantásticos!

    Um grande abraço


    PS. Tenho de fechar o tópico? Como faço?

    Conteúdo patrocinado


    Tabelas relacionadas em combo box Empty Re: Tabelas relacionadas em combo box

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 8/11/2024, 21:16